Skip to content
This repository has been archived by the owner on Mar 12, 2021. It is now read-only.

Move build forward #57

Open
15 of 17 tasks
moozzyk opened this issue Dec 18, 2014 · 0 comments
Open
15 of 17 tasks

Move build forward #57

moozzyk opened this issue Dec 18, 2014 · 0 comments
Milestone

Comments

@moozzyk
Copy link
Contributor

moozzyk commented Dec 18, 2014

  • make sure we can build Debug and Release versions and they work
  • enable building dll
  • create NuGet package
  • consider linking casablanca statically (http://katyscode.wordpress.com/2014/04/01/how-to-statically-link-the-c-rest-sdk-casablanca/, https://casablanca.codeplex.com/workitem/18)
  • Windows platforms
    • Win32
    • x64
    • WinRt
    • toolsets(?) - v120 and v140 are now supported
    • support for VS2015 (toolsets, platforms) - currently blocked - Casablanca does not support websockets on VS2015
  • add calling conventions explicitly to public functions
  • file/package versioning
  • set file attributes (?)
  • sign dll (digital signature)
  • support non-windows platform (TBD - platforms/compilers, CMake vs GYB, etc.)
  • move casablanca to 2.3.0 2.4.0.1 2.6.0
  • run static analysis
@moozzyk moozzyk mentioned this issue Jun 8, 2015
@muratg muratg added this to the Backlog milestone Sep 9, 2015
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ants